All 35th Anniversary cars use the 4.0 River V8 with the rather complex GEMS ignition and fuelling control. This does give better fuel consumption and slightly more torque, but it is quite complex and is prone to electronic gremlins.
The earlier long door cars 1997 to 2002 use the 3.9 River V8 engine with the less complex “Hotwire” system controlling the fuelling only, and a distributor for ignition. This is a much simpler system and arguably is better suited to the Morgan application.
However as is always the case I would still buy any Morgan based on condition. Beware of cars that have too low mileage. These cars need exercise, not years in a garage.

I have a U.S version 35th Anniversary edition and was told when I bought the car from the original owner that there were 105 made. I don't know if he was accurate or not.
My car has the GEMS system and so far two related problems. One was a failure of the mass air flow sensor. The car will still run, but barely. Easy fix as long as you're not out in the middle of nowhere like I was. The other is the continual problem with the imobilizer not wanting to communicate with the engine management computer, it cranks but no start. I have had it reset but shortly the problem returns. Cycle the ignition switch 3 times and it starts every time. I know some other 35th edition owners and they have never experienced the problem.
Otherwise it has been a great car. Gas mileage has been 28 - 30 miles per U.S. gallon on the highway.
